Output 86f164bd3ef4a878fcc13dcd8a8cb4000ed97a734be4e5d2b8a7df1b03735fb9:0

value
30884217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2ef62083094feba021e308a63f7993e0b3bbc1 OP_EQUAL
address
3HCs46KYCNBnXFBj87DaXdgFoLqJRSkjn9
transaction
86f164bd3ef4a878fcc13dcd8a8cb4000ed97a734be4e5d2b8a7df1b03735fb9
confirmations
265315
spent
true